Kati Preston, an 83-year-old Hungarian Holocaust survivor, spoke to eighth grade students of her experiences as a five-year-old Jewish girl before and during World War II.  She brought a message of showing love over hate, and telling students. “This generation can mend the world.”

Our eighth students are studying the Holocaust and having Ms. Preston share her experiences was both powerful and impactful.
